This would be an impossible ask for me. My door creaks and now I wonder if I am on the path to an impossible hinge problem.
Where is the place to put grease? And if don't have a working grease gun, will spray grease or spray silicone work?

As long as the hinge pins haven't contacted the steel outside the bushings and the bushings haven't moved to expand the holes, you should be able to install new bushings and hinge pins.

As for lubrication, I've used white lithium spray grease to apply it to where the pins contact the bushings.
